Rosaries are an iconic tattoo design associated with Catholicism; however, you’ll often see Christians of various denominations sporting them too. Rosary tattoos can serve as an incredible way of showing devotion to your religion and your chosen spiritual path. Rosaries are symbols used for prayer that contain many different meanings and blessings that can be found in rosary books. A rosary can also be combined with other designs to create unique tattoos with special significance for you. Some individuals prefer having just a single bead on their rosary tattoo, while others opt for full-length bracelets as these make covering it for religious events or ceremonies easier.

Angel tattoos are striking and symbolic body art pieces, symbolizing everything from innocence to a spiritual connection with God. These celestial beings are widely believed to serve as protectors of the universe, protecting people from accidents or potential danger. Their influence may also help those grieving a departed loved one find comfort from beyond. A fallen angel can be an eye-catching design as they symbolize innocence lost or the gap between good and evil. These designs often depict them with sad eyes looking downward and their head turned away from the heavens as an indication of despair. Another popular angel tattoo style involves an angel sitting atop a rock and gazing thoughtfully into space. This design is often chosen by women looking for something more feminine and serene.
